Do you Understand about BMP's? If not you need a Crash Course.

Talking about how you use the State , city or county's bMPs is great. Plus you can Add you take extra Steps to go above and Beyond always Maintaining the environment for Generation to come. I would not Get long with this, if they quiz you on specific examples Talk about not discharging water of Property as your first line of defense practicing the Simple collecting debris an pollutants existing prior to washing.


theres more but I would not go into much depth at the Learning curve your at.
